Ek_Bacharach by Elme Bekker 2011 SAFW Range Sells On Carnet De Mode
Another big news for a South African designer, Elme Bekker, as her 2011 (SAFW) South African Fashion Week range were chosen to be sold on Carnet de Mode, a Paris based platform for selected fashion designers.
The first collection for Ek_Bacharach was shown at South Africa Fashion Week in March 2011 by Elme Bekker as part of a sponsorship package by Elle Magazine, Mr Price and SAFW for Elle New Talent 2010. The range was received with a high level of press and editorial exposure.
"We are currently enjoying interest from shopping platforms such as Carnet de Mode in France (www.carnetdemode.com ) and NJAL in Great Brittain (www.notjustalabel.com). We consider this opportunity a great step up as most of these online shops feature industry influentials such as Robin Schulié (head buyer of the iconic Maria Luisa Store in Paris) and cult-favourite blogger Diane Pernet as guest curators."
